tailieunhanh - Bài giảng Cơ sở dữ liệu: Bài 6 - Đại học CNTT

Bài giảng Cơ sở dữ liệu - Bài 6 trang bị cho người học những hiểu biết về ngôn ngữ tân từ. Các nội dung chính được trình bày trong chương này gồm có: Cú pháp, các định nghĩa, diễn giải của một công thức, quy tắc lượng giá công thức, ngôn ngữ tân từ có biến là n bộ, ngôn ngữ tân từ có biến là miền giá trị. . | Bài 6 Ngôn ngữ tân từ Khoa HTTT - Đại học CNTT Nội dung 1 1 S 1. 2. 1 1 1 1 Giới thiệu Cú pháp 3. 4. 5. 6. Các định nghĩa Diễn giải của một công thức Quy tắc lượng giá công thức Ngôn ngữ tân từ có biến là n bộ 7. Ngôn ngữ tân từ có biến là miền giá trị Khoa HTTT - Đại học CNTT 2 1 1. Giới thiệu r I Ngôn ngữ tân từ là ngôn ngữ truy vấn hình thức do Codd đề nghị 1972-1973 được Lacroit Proix và Ullman phát triên cài đặt trong một sô ngôn ngữ như QBE ALPHA. Đặc điểm Ngôn ngữ phi thủ tục Rút trích cái gì chứ không phải rút trích như thế nào Khả năng diễn đạt tương đương với đại sô quan hệ ---- Có hai loại Có biến là n bộ Có biến là miền giá trị Khoa HTTT - Đại học CNTT 3 2. Cú pháp I biêu thức trong ngoặc Biến dùng chữ thường ở cuôi bộ ký tự x y z t s. Hằng dùng chữ thường ở đầu bộ ký tự a b c . Hàm là một ánh xạ từ một miền giá trị vào tập hợp gồm 2 giá trị đúng hoặc sai. Thường dùng chữ thường ở giữa bộ ký tự h g f . Tân từ là một biêu thức được xây dựng dựa trên biêu thức logic. Dùng chữ in hoa ở giữa bộ ký tự P Q R. Các phép toán logic phủ định kéo theo và a hoặc v . Các lượng từ với mọi V tồn tại 3 Khoa HTTT - Đại học CNTT 4 2 3. Các định nghĩa 1 ---- I I Định nghĩa 1 Tân từ 1 ngôi Tân từ 1 ngôi được định nghĩa trên tập X và biến x có giá trị chạy trên các phân tử của X. Với mỗi giá trị của x tân từ P x là một mệnh đề logic tức là nó có giá trị đúng Đ hoặc sai S Ví dụ P x x là biến chạy trên X là một tân từ P gt gteX là một mệnh đề X Nguyen Van A Tran Thi B Với tân từ NỮ x được xác định x là người nữ . Khi đó Mệnh đề NỮ Nguyen Van A cho kết quả Sai NỮ Tran Thi B cho kết quả Đúng Khoa HTTT - Đại học CNTT 5 3. Các định nghĩa 2 I Định nghĩa 2 Tân từ n ngôi Tân từ n ngôi được định nghĩa trên các tập X1 X2 . Xn và n biến x1 x2 . xn lấy giá trị trên các tập Xi tương ứng. Với mỗi giá trị aieXi xi từ n ngôi là một mệnh đề. Ký hiệu P xb x2 . xj - Ví dụ CHA x1 x2 x1 là CHA của x2 Chú ý Các Xi không nhất thiết phải là rời nhau Với xi ai P x1 x2 . ai . xn là tân từ n-1

TỪ KHÓA LIÊN QUAN